The Hanover Borough Stormwater Authority is set to embark on a transformative project that promises to enhance local environmental management and generate significant revenue for the community. During the recent meeting held on April 8, 2025, officials discussed a partnership with Earthcare Solutions to develop a new facility at the old wastewater treatment plant site. This facility will utilize advanced technology to process biosolids, creating biochar and reducing environmental risks associated with waste disposal.
The project is unique as it leverages the borough's existing water infrastructure to service multiple surrounding communities, allowing access to lower interest financing through state revolving funds. This financial model is expected to yield annual revenue streams of between $500,000 and $1 million for the stormwater authority, which can be reinvested into local green infrastructure programs without imposing new taxes or fees on residents.
Earthcare Solutions will assume full responsibility for the design, construction, and operation of the facility, including securing necessary state permits and insurance. This arrangement minimizes financial risk for the borough, as there are no operational expense responsibilities on their part. The partnership also aims to create approximately 15 new local jobs and reduce disposal costs for biosolids, which have seen significant price increases in recent years.
The facility is designed to process up to 60,000 wet tons of biosolids annually, with potential for expansion based on feedstock availability. It will incorporate systems to manage odors and emissions, ensuring compliance with environmental standards. The project is positioned to not only address current waste management challenges but also to future-proof the borough's infrastructure against rising disposal costs and regulatory changes.
Looking ahead, the timeline for the project includes finalizing design and permitting this summer, with hopes to begin construction by late 2025 and operations by mid-2026.
